What is AR and How Does It Work with the Oculus Quest 2?
Augmented reality is a technology that overlays digital information onto the real world. When combined with the Oculus Quest 2, AR games can create an immersive experience that feels like you’re actually inside the game. The Quest 2’s inside-out tracking sensors and high-resolution display make it an ideal platform for AR gaming.
Here’s a brief overview of how AR works with the Oculus Quest 2:
Component | Description |
---|---|
Inside-out Tracking | Enables the Quest 2 to track your movements without external sensors, allowing for a seamless AR experience. |
High-resolution Display | Delivers a clear and crisp image, making the AR experience more immersive. |
Hand Tracking | Enables you to interact with the game using your hands, adding a new level of realism to the AR experience. |

How to Get Started with Free AR Games on the Oculus Quest 2
Getting started with free AR games on the Oculus Quest 2 is a straightforward process:
- Make sure your Oculus Quest 2 is charged and connected to the internet.
- Open the Oculus app on your smartphone or tablet.
- Sign in with your Oculus account.
- Search for the game you want to download.
- Select the game and download it to your Quest 2.
- Once the game is downloaded, launch it from the Oculus app and start playing.
